See if this helps. When you are typing a message, right above the text box there is a little picture of a paper clip (just to the right of the smiley face). Click the paper clip, then select browse. This will bring you to all the junk stored on your computer. When you find the file (picture) you want, select open. Repeat until you have all the pictures you want. Then select upload and wait! Be patient, it can take a few minutes.

Another way to post a picture saved on your computer is instead of clicking on the paperclip is to type your words in the text box, scroll down to "Additional Options", then "Manage Attachments" and you'll see the same thing as if you clicked on the paper clip. This works for a New Thread and Reply to Thread but not if you use "Quick Reply". Much easier than posting from a photo sharing site.
